The Defense Advanced Research Projects Agency (DARPA) is soliciting innovative proposals in the following technical area: physics and nonlinear control of inertial measurement units (IMUs) appropriate for tactical and unmanned missions. The Precision Inertial Navigation & Positioning On an Integrated Tesseract (PINPOINT) program will challenge the research community to overcome the decade-long performance plateau of micro-electro-mechanical systems (MEMS) IMUs by exploring revolutionary sensor architectures that operate in highly nonlinear regimes. DARPA is soliciting proposals for the research and development of novel inertial sensors based on physics such as, but not limited to, electromagnetically levitated proof masses, non-linear resonators, and high-velocity tethered microsystems. A central theme of this program is the tight co-design of the physical sensor package with advanced, real-time adaptive control systems necessary to stabilize and harness these complex dynamics. Performers should investigate innovative approaches that enable revolutionary advances in science, devices, or systems. Specifically excluded is research that primarily results in evolutionary improvements to the existing state of practice.
Funding Opportunity Number: HR001126S0016. Assistance Listing: 12.910. Funding Instrument: CA,O,PC. Category: ST.

Or search similar grants →According to the current listing, eligibility includes: Eligible applicants: Others (see text field entitled Additional Information on Eligibility for clarification). All responsible sources capable of satisfying the Government's needs may submit a proposal that shall be considered by DARPA. See the Eligibility Information section of the BAA for more information. Applications for Precision Inertial Navigation & Positioning On an Integrated Tesseract (PINPOINT) are due September 25, 2026. Build your timeline backwards from this date to cover registrations, approvals, and final submission checks.
